What a splendid "find", PJ.
Interestingly on page 188 it gives the slip for a paddle at only 15.37%
whereas the slip for the screw is given as 26.20%. I think that screw design
must have come quite a long way since then. I seem to remember that when I
was at sea, we used to record somewhere about the same figure as is given
for the paddle.
Also interesting that a paddle looses 18.00% as "oblique action". Was that
for feathering or fixed floats ? One has to wonder how they came up with
such accurate figures (two decimal places!)!! Must have been mighty
difficult to measure some of these forces and losses!!
